During the 1st quarter of 2019, real estate activity in Canton saw decreases in both total sales volume and average sales price.
There was a 2% increase in the number of land documents recorded at the Norfolk County Registry of Deeds from the town of Canton during the 1st quarter 2019. 977 land documents were recorded versus 962 during the first quarter 2018.
The total volume of real estate sales in Canton during the 1st quarter 2019 was $62,157,865, a 70% decrease from the same time period in 2018. Also, the average sale price of homes and commercial property was down 66% in Canton. The average sale price was $900,838. These figures were impacted by the $76 million sale of the former Reebox headquarters in March 2018.
The number of mortgages recorded (199) on Canton properties during the 1st quarter 2019 was up 6% compared to the previous year. Also, total mortgage indebtedness increased 3% to $107,188,758 during the same period.
There were 2 foreclosure deeds filed against Canton properties during the 1st quarter 2019 compared to 0 foreclosure deeds filed during the 1st quarter 2018.
Finally, homestead activity decreased 8% in Canton during the 1st quarter 2019 with 199 homesteads filed compared to 188 during the same time period in 2018.
